HAMPTON, Ga. – The big surprise in qualifying Friday night at Atlanta Motor Speedway? Well, Mike Skinner qualifying well might not be a surprise, but his getting the No. 84 Red Bull Racing team into the Kobalt Tools 500 on Sunday could have been.
The Red Bull team had yet to make a race this year with AJ Allmendinger behind the wheel, while teammate Brian Vickers has now made all four events. Skinner is replacing Allmendinger on a temporary basis.
“You’re always disappointed when you think you can do better,” said Skinner, who will start 34th. “Our first goal was to get the car in the race. They struggled to make races. We got the first goal accomplished, and now it’s just a matter of getting better and giving them the proper feedback so they can get better.”
Of the drivers who had to qualify on speed, Skinner was sixth. Vickers took the final spot as seventh on that list. BAM Racing’s Ken Schrader was 0.046 seconds slower than Skinner and didn’t make the race.
Skinner said he pushed it on his second lap.
“You have to somewhat be conservative,” Skinner said. “They didn’t say anything on the radio in the first lap and banzai’d it on the second lap and about wrecked it. “
